I understand that many of you feel that you've been here for a long time, and have contributed to the website one way or another. aa.com is facing a difficult choice, and I want to hear you opinion.
Now the real question is, do we stay focus on MoH: X or do we move on and cover more.
If we stay aa.com, we will continue cover mainly the MoH series. Everything will stay almost exactly the same, except we will have a news miner and a squad registering system that I mentioned before when MoH:PA comes out. Plus adir the file submission and approval system. Appearence-wise I suppose the website will remain the same look, maybe some minor changes. No one needs to contribute anything this way.
If we go gf1.com, we will cover all mil-shooters. The site will (need to) look completely different. Feature-wise all necessary tools that I can think of are already in place (adir for file posting, for example). But I will need dedicated individuals to run different sections (games) for me. We will also need a completely new look and by god I'm not going to have time to design a new layout. AA.com will be no more, it's not feasible to run two sites at the same time whilst one of them covers the topic of the other one anyway. As far as the forum is concerned, prepare for noobs attack, especially for the offtopic section; more "vets" will leave in despair, more floods more attacks, and we will probably need more mods. But you will be a part of something bigger.
To be honest, I have been busy as hell at work, and I don't remember when was the last time I played MoH:AA, or any other shooters for that matter. I rarely have time to read or follow gaming news anymore, and I think I'm the only MoHTeam member who had never visited the MoHTeam forum; whereas two years ago I was constantly communicating with almost every single member on 2015 and related staffs at EA. I am now completely "out of sync" with the community. Someone better than me will need to run various part of the website. On the other hand, I am still able to administrate the web server, create or add custom scripts, fix shit up here and there, etc.
Anyhoo, if we go gf1.com, I ask nothing tangible from anyone of you, but time, and some dedication for the community; and if we go gf1.com, then we will need to figure out a game plan, like right now.
Let me know what you think then.
